alt-b83b82e0 1e20 11f0 8f53 3fcd3a8325c7 RVy2vz

IPTV Deals & Subscriptions https://tvdeals.store

Chelsea are used to winning in England but when it comes to facing Barcelona in Europe, the shoe is on the other foot. Can they turn things around?